Museum of Natural History in Jelenia Góra
Renovated in 2010-2013 with funding under the Regional Operational Program of the Lower Silesian Voivodship. 6.4 Cultural Tourism: "The Pocysters Team in Jelenia Góra-Cieplice The investor and the main beneficiary was the City of Jelenia Gora Partners: Piarist College and Roman-Catholic Parish St. John the Baptist Operated by: Museum of Natural History in Jelenia Góra
The object (part of the Museum) is half of the former Cistercian monastery preserved in Krzeszów in Cieplice. The second part is occupied by the College of the Piarist Order.
The entire Cistercian team is located on the local branch of the "Southwestern Cistercian Trail", which is part of the international "European Cistercian Route".
The main building of the presbytery of the Cistercian monastery (included in the museum and monastery part) was entered in the register of monuments under No. 1397 dated 17 September 1965.
